Sun in the 10th House Synastry

In synastry, when one person’s Sun is in another person’s 10th house, it can be a powerful and positive connection. The Sun person is seen as a source of inspiration and motivation by the 10th house person, and they can help each other to achieve their goals.

What does it mean?

The 10th house is associated with career, public image, and social status. When someone’s Sun is in this house, it suggests that they are ambitious and driven to succeed. They are also likely to be seen as leaders and authority figures.

The Sun person in this synastry aspect is likely to be a positive force in the 10th house person’s life. They can help the 10th house person to achieve their career goals and to gain recognition for their accomplishments. The Sun person can also help the 10th house person to develop their self-confidence and to become more assertive.

Synastry with your partner

If your Sun is in your partner’s 10th house, you are likely to be a source of inspiration and motivation for them. You can help them to achieve their career goals and to reach their full potential. You are also likely to be a positive influence on their public image and social status.

Your partner is likely to see you as a leader and an authority figure. They may admire your ambition and your drive to succeed. They may also be attracted to your confidence and your sense of purpose.
